I have a Master Server which is a RP2470 with 1024KB of memory and we process about 1500 backups per day through it.  In the past two weeks I have experienced Code 150s, but the backups were not cancelled by an administrator, but by the system.  Here is the error we receive when it occurs:

3688660: 05:05:29.648 [10196] <16> start_backup_job: fork error: Not enough space (12)

3688661:
05:05:29.648 [10196] <16> run_any_ret_level: failure starting backup job, PID=-1

When this happens nothing else will schedule unti we either restart all the NB process or reboot the server, and I have done both.  We logged a call on this and there is no fix for this as of yet but there is one planned in 5.1MP7 which is due out sometime this month.  The recommendation was to increase the memory on the server (I realize 1GB is extremely low), and we should be receiving it shortly.  I have load balanced the schedule as much as I can.  Has anyone else experienced this issue and if so do you have any information that would be helpful?  The first two times this happened I rebooted the server and the subsequent outages all I did was recycle the application.  Im looking for any and all opinions on this topic.
